Heads up, support folks: a few of the Tarnwick build agents drift by several seconds because their NTP sync fights with the hypervisor clock. This matters because the Lanternfall artifact store timestamps rows on insert, and skewed agents can make builds look like they finished before they started. If a customer reports "negative build duration," that's the cause — not corruption. To verify, compare agent time against the store's clock. Query the artifact metadata database using the connection string below.

replica DSN, kajep-yahag: mssql://praok_svc:iF@db-8d68.plorvaio.local:5432/eliion

**Mgmt Meeting Minutes — Retiring the Brightline Range**

Quick recap for sales leads at Fenholt Supplies: we agreed to retire the Brightline fixture range by year-end. Remaining stock moves to clearance pricing next month, and accounts on standing orders get migrated to the Lumetta range. Trade-in incentives were approved in principle. The confidential note on next steps sits just below.

board note of bajof-bajeg: The pricing group signed off on a budget of $13.4 million for Project Sildor. The renewal with Lamixek Holdings closes at $48.9 million a year, 49 percent above the last contract.

The Harkline admin console supports bulk edits on the Accounts table via the batch endpoint. Bulk operations are gated behind a server-side flag and a signing credential so that stray scripts cannot mass-update rows. Maintainers should never enable bulk mode in shared staging without coordinating in the ops channel, since edits are not reversible past the retention window. Configuration lives in the standard env file next to the pagination limits. Below this sentence, append the bulk-edit signing key on its own line.

vault entry, yahaf-tagug: LEDGER_TOKEN20=884d77d1a8b98aa4edfb

Onboarding note for security review: the Bramblegate payroll export moved from XML to signed JSON envelopes in release 9. Each envelope carries a detached signature validated by the Coffer service before ingestion. Sample envelopes for your review sit in the sealed fixtures bundle, which unlocks with the recovery passphrase stated directly below.

vault phrase of bafop-bagep = holael-quenwyn